1. Soldat 2
  2. News

Soldat 2 News

15 new maps + fixes/improvements!

[h2]New maps[/h2]
7 maps improved. 15 maps added. Some of the new ones:


ctf_brutalist by challz


ctf_busta by challz


ctf_basalt by proto


ctf_jungle by challz


dm_stratum by Jok


dm_zero by proto


dm_gear by proto


dm_solstice by challz


[h2]Ranked fixes[/h2]
Some of the most annoying bugs in ranked play have been fixed: like spectator being stuck on dead player and side menu interfering with cursor (you can disable it entirely in settings now).

Also due to the constant great work by Norbo and jrgp the ranked matches and servers are much more stable now.

[h2]Weapon modifier[/h2]
Changes from last version can be compared here: https://www.diffchecker.com/6mF7J5Ic/
Feedback is welcome!

[h2]Scripting improvements[/h2]
Fixes based on feedback + added file read/writing support.
Check Scripts/Standard/Example01.cs and Scripts/Standard/Example02.cs

[h2]Changelog:[/h2]
[expand]
[22.02.2023] 0.8.63a
added dm_rift (Jok), dm_zero (proto), dm_solstice (challz), dm_lab (proto), dm_stratum (Jok), dm_gear (proto)
added ctf_busta (challz), ctf_brutalist (challz), ctf_jungle (challz), ctf_basalt (proto)
added ctf_anthill (proto), ctf_newbia (proto), ctf_spark (Vauat & Turko), ctf_huracan (darDar), ctf_hive (Jok)
updated ctf_limbo by proto (better colors https://discord.com/channels/498800300199772162/844258244372856872/1069012038938013797)
updated ctf_tyrus by darDar (layout changes https://discord.com/channels/498800300199772162/844258244372856872/1068543125670342806)
updated ctf_lanubya (layout changes)
updated ctf_x (removed big boxes from the bridge)
updated ctf_ash (removed big boxes near the flag)
updated ctf_dopamine by MM (better movement flow in mid route, improved spawn location, fixed flag spawn, some more details
updated by darDar (small layout changes)
fixed spectator blocked on dead player
fixed Domination not working
fixed Input, TryGetComponent and other minor scripting issues
added script Example02.cs showing how to read/write files
fixed join url region case sensitive

[10.02.2023] 0.8.62t
side menu hides and is not responsive faster after key released
fixed player match history error
added compiling scripts... popup
script docs updated (https://soldat2.com/docs)

[06.02.2023] 0.8.61t
Barrett ready sound improved (like in S1)
added Barrett fire ready sound after reload clip
fixed bink still there after picking up or changing weapon
removed player left chat message when spectator leaves
fixed match start affected by spectators count
fixed radio commands interfering with mouse control
added GameSettings.ShowRadioCommands to disable the display of radio commands
fixed client changes to _default.json affecting multiplayer games
weapon modifier changes (https://www.diffchecker.com/6mF7J5Ic/)
[/expand]

More stuff coming, stay tuned on Discord!
Have fun!
MM

SURVIVAL UPDATE

SURVIVAL

Survival mode known from S1 and from games like Counter-Strike is finally here in S2!
It's a modifier so you can try it with all the gamemodes (especially Domination!).
Just select it from the modifiers in the Lobby menu and off you go!

NEW RANKED MODES

Together with Norbo we are bringing a massive new change to ranked game modes. We can now have a totally unique custom game mode for ranked with a dedicated leaderboard.



A "playlist" is a ranked setting, e.g. CTF 3v3 is one playlist, DM Knife Only size 5 is another playlist. Players have separate ranks on each playlist, It's not shared between CTF 2v2 and CTF 3v3 for example.

Also, numerous bug fixes and improvments have been done to make ranked games more stable (thanks to Norbo and jrgp).

NEW MAPS



ctf_dusk by darDar


ctf_atlantis by darDar


ctf_voland by MM/Proto


dm_soldat - new default lobby map by Proto

And last but not least some improvements for better movement in:
ctf_snakebite
ctf_ash
ctf_limbo


WEAPONS MOD IMPROVEMENTS

RocketLauncher damage should be more consistent.
Most weapons use leg/torso/head modifiers.
Fixed Barret triple penetration
Lowered most weapon flag push forces
Most weapons have penetration
Detailed weapon mod changes (https://www.diffchecker.com/Twp3SjZv)

C# SCRIPTING


Scripting allows for modifying every aspect of the game logic. As well as making new game modes and new modifiers. It's still very new, so it's briefly documented and there's little examples. But if you are dedicated enough and know a bit of C# and Unity you'll find it good to go!

Quick start from faq.txt:
Place your custom scripts in Soldat2/Scripts/Custom
Check console for errors (Alt + ~).
Use RELOAD command to recompile scripts.

Engine documentation
https://soldat2.com/docs/

Unity documentation (most things in S2 engine are fundamentally Unity)
https://docs.unity3d.com/2020.1/Documentation/Manual/index.html

Check "Scripts/Standard/Climb.cs" for a very simple example.
"Rules/Standard/Climb.json" for the gamemode implementation.

Check "Scripts/Standard/Survival.cs" for a modifier script example.
"Modifiers/Standard/Survival.json" for the modifier implementation.


CHANGELOG


0.8.46a - 0.8.60a
(changes are displayed in inverse chronological order as they were released for testing)

[expand]
[05.01.2023] 0.8.60a hotfix
ranked: fixed end game screen
ranked: fixed match history for DM
ranked: fixed stats not updating when changing playlist
fixed scoreboard ranks
fixed scoreboard player profile click

[03.01.2023] 0.8.60a
Deathmatch, TeamDeathmatch timelimit 5min->4min
Deathmatch minimum scorelimit 25->20 (but increases with more players)
fixed scorelimit scale to keep minimum
added ctf_dusk, ctf_atlantic, ctf_voland to CTF map pool
replaced ctf_ash-bettermovement, ctf_snakebite2 as default
added year/month/day timestamp to console logs
fixed survival script issue in deathmatch

[12.10.2022] 0.8.53t
fixed TDM issues when score limit set to 0
ranked: added global playlist selector in Career
ranked: fixed match history
ranked: added playlist name to Home rank
ranked: fixed ranks in scoreboard

[06.10.2022] 0.8.52t
added test maps (ctf_ash-bettermovement, ctf_dusk, ctf_atlantis, ctf_voland, ctf_snakebite2)
added dm_soldat by proto as default lobby map
fixed jets trail teleport issue
fixed /listmaps inconsistent response
fixed adding duplicate modifiers with /addmodifier

[21.09.2022] 0.8.51t
added link to players stats.soldat2.com profile when clicked in scoreboard
added map cycle for domination
ranked: added tdm survival
ranked: added 2,4 player knife-only
ranked: added 2,3,5 player deathmatch
removed scoreboard ranks
main menu rank is last leaderboard playlist rank
server: fixed rcon addmodifier

[20.09.2022] 0.8.50t
ranked: fixed current games
ranked: fixed discord integration
ranked: fixed end game results
fixed flag glow not appearing if flag dropped in base

[14.09.2022] 0.8.49t
ranked: matches are now based on specific playlists
ranked: removed popup before ranked
ranked: darker filter dropdown colors
fixed carried flag desync issue
fixed players team not changing during loading/connecting
weapon mod changes (https://www.diffchecker.com/Twp3SjZv)
most weapons use leg/torso/head modifiers
fixed Barret triple penetration
lowered most weapon flag push forces
most weapons have penetration
fixed json logs spam
fixed RGD5 network object logs spam

[6.09.2022] 0.8.48t
added working Survival for Domination
fixed ending screen in CTF showing 0:0 when tied round
fixed one team cheering when round tied
deadly polygon outline color changed to black

[31.08.2022] 0.8.47t
added Survival modifier
fixed announcer saying won/lost when spectating
fixed bot trying to shoot with overheated minigun
fixed RocketLauncher rocket damage tied to velocity
new ExperimentalWeapons modifier for testing
fixed spectator next/prev to dead
[/expand]

S2 WIKI

We have a Soldat 2 wiki!

https://wiki.soldat2.com/index.php?title=Main_Page

Check out the Important Links section for some cool pages like Active Players Dashboard


S2 MAPPING SHOWCASE

Thanks to jrgp we have a mapping showcase webcase like in S1.

https://tms2.jrgp.org/

WHAT'S NEXT?


Stay tuned for Tournaments organized on Discord!

Price drop! It's $8,99 now, so much lower than it was but still higher than what you got during the Winter Sale. I hope this brings in more players.

Next update will be a bit later (few weeks, maybe months) unless there's a need for a hotfix or some weapon mod changes. As explained on Discord, I'm in big financial worries cause S2 isn't bringing that much money so I decided to quickly make another small single player game, telease it and return back to S2. My long term plans for S2 are still to make it F2P.
https://store.steampowered.com/app/1482380/Maniac/

Can't wait, see you then.

And have fun!
MM

CTF tournament

Hi folks,

...whether you've been consistently grinding in the ranked queues, or play Soldat 2 occasionally to relax, it's time to put on your rocket boots and prepare yourself for some unforgettable moments!

As activity and interest around the competitive ranked mode has increased in the past few months, we think it's about time to announce the first Soldat 2 CTF tournament!

This is the first-of-its-kind, inaugural Soldat 2 tournament and you can expect an evening full of well-spirited competition, clutch flag caps, and a huge amount of fun. We're counting on our beloved community to sign-up and hoping for a very good turnout!

Although this is a competitive event format, we're encouraging players of all skill levels to sign up. You do not need to be in a team to play. We're going with a format of maximum 21 players (7 teams of 3) that fight it out in a group stage, leading into the play-offs. Due to the insane interest and amount of sign-ups we may change the format depending on the total number of players signed-up, so sign-up as soon as possible.

This tournament map pool is the current ranked map pool, as well as 3 new community maps chosen by the contestants. Every player who signs up to the tournament can put out a vote on their 3 favourite maps from the new community maps below. The three maps with the most votes will be added to the tournaments map pool.



To sign-up and for more details, quickly join Discord and check out the #tournament-announcements channel!

Ranked Thursday

Hi folks,

This is your weekly event for Ranked Thursday (Nov 24), see you then!

Join Discord

Ranked Thursday

Hi folks,

This is your weekly event for Ranked Thursday (Nov 17), see you then!

Join Discord